Where I'm From

Where I'm From.mp3
Wrote this about a year ago and just rediscovered it.

   Where I’m from
   I’m no one
    Just taking up space under the dying sun where I’m from
   Where I’m from
   You buy your fun
   I can’t forget the things I’ve done where I‘m from 
Every time I woke up I was a little surprised
And I wondered why I kept myself alive
And god knows this place was ready to die
But it was all I’d ever known
And I only ever meant to pass you by
But your home looks so pretty from up in the sky
It’s been a long way and I’m fixing to die
I should’ve thought of that before I left home
But when you looked at me with that empty, burning stare
And you looked right on through my eyes as if I wasn’t there
You took me right on back to the place where I was before
With the stagnant, dirty air
Full of faces I can’t recall anymore
You know I’m not unused to being alone
If you must know it reminds me of home
   Where I’m from
   What I’ve done 
   Another piece of the past I can’t outrun where I’m from
   Where you’re from
   There’s a different sun
   How can I make you understand how far I’ve come? This is not where I come from
Pardon my denial but I’d like to believe
That the folks back home still think about me
It’s strange but I feel like I’m finally free
And now I must learn to lie
But surely this freedom will come at a cost
Hate is just as potent and fear is not lost
What I am must remain hidden inside my thoughts
How strange is your foreign sky
Shall I return to those who sent me here
Or shall I stay and learn to live with fear
I should’ve left this place when I still could
Gone back to where I’m from
Been a hero under my sun
I can’t remember why I’ve come
Since you went and trapped me here for good
I don’t understand why I can’t let you go
But thanks to you I will die so far from home
